Tools of the Trade: Essential Technologies for Investors

Today’s Investors enjoy access to an arsenal of tools designed to make investing more straightforward and informed – which has fundamentally altered our view on investing. From traditional investment methods to tech-driven ones – investors now have more technology at their fingertips than ever!

Are Tech-Savvy Investors More Successful?

Investment platforms like Robinhood and E*TRADE has transformed access to stock markets for everyone by providing user-friendly interfaces and real-time market data, making trading accessible even for novice investors. Portfolio management software such as Personal Capital and Wealth front allows investors to keep track of investments, monitor performance, and receive tailored advice based on individual financial goals – it’s like having their financial adviser right in their pocket!

Robo-advisors are incredible revolutionary innovations. Platforms such as Betterment and Wealth simple use algorithms to automate investment management for you based on factors like risk tolerance, goals, and time horizon – offering an effortless investment approach! Isn’t technology unique?

Coinbase and Binance cryptocurrency exchanges provide investors with new avenues of investment beyond stocks and bonds; accessing digital assets has given investors new options for diversifying portfolios beyond conventional stocks and bonds.

Data-Driven Decision Making: Leveraging Big Data and Analytics

In the investment world, data is critical. Sifting through vast amounts of information can dramatically affect decisions and outcomes; imagine having to search through piles of clutter when trying to locate something; big data makes that job much more straightforward!

Big data analysis tools like Bloomberg Terminal and FactSet are invaluable resources for investors. These platforms collect information from multiple sources – financial statements, market trends, and economic indicators- to help investors make more informed decisions. Machine learning plays an essential part in forecasting market trends. Platforms like Kenshoo and Quant Connect utilize machine learning algorithms to detect patterns in market movements and anticipate shifts that could occur, giving investors an invaluable advantage.

Sentiment analysis is another cutting-edge use of big data. By analyzing social media posts, news articles, and other forms of online content, such as Market Psych’s platform, Market Psych can measure public sentiment on specific stocks or markets – providing invaluable insight into how market sentiment could alter stock prices.

Algorithmic Trading: Automated Investment Strategies

Algorithmic trading has revolutionized the investment world. This technology has revolutionized investment strategy by utilizing algorithms that execute trades based on predefined criteria – similar to having an automated trader without emotional biases associated with human traders.

HFT (high-frequency trading) is algorithmic trading that executes numerous orders quickly at incredible speed, such as Virtu Financial or Citadel Securities’ HFT offerings. This form focuses on exploiting market price discrepancies to maximize profit returns! Witness how speed and precision make seemingly small profit margins yield hugely rewarding profits!

Have you heard of quant trading? This strategy relies heavily on quantitative analysis for decision-making when trading, using firms such as Two Sigma and Renaissance Technologies, which employ mathematicians and data scientists to construct models that accurately forecast market movements before employing these models to execute trades that often outpace conventional investment strategies in performance.

Algo-trading platforms like MetaTrader and NinjaTrader enable individual investors to develop and test their algorithms with backtesting features that show how those strategies would have historically performed in markets. It is truly unique how such tools level the playing field for individual investors!

Risk Management: How Technology Enhances Risk Assessment

Assessing Risk with Technology Risk analysis is integral to making investments worthwhile, and technology has revolutionized how we assess and mitigate it – making the process more precise and comprehensive than ever.

Riskalyze and MSCI Barra offer investors tools to identify hidden dangers in their portfolios by assessing volatility, correlation, and exposure across asset classes. With these tools at their disposal, investors are given a complete picture of any associated risks for informed decision-making if they ever feel they are taking blind leaps into investments – providing much-needed guidance when taking leaps of faith with investments.

Real-time monitoring is another crucial component of modern risk management. Platforms like Bloomberg and Reuters provide real-time market movements, economic indicators, geopolitical events, and geospatial events so users can stay aware of potential threats before they arise; similar to having a crystal ball warn them before any obstacles appear, real-time data provides real-time updates identical to having that crystal ball warn us before encountering obstacles in their path.

Stress testing tools simulate different market situations to simulate how a portfolio would fare under various conditions, like economic recession or market crashes. By simulating different situations and testing against such events, investors can more accurately pinpoint any vulnerabilities within their investments that might compromise long-term performance; stress testing tools act like fitness routines for investments to make sure they remain healthy into the future.

Automating risk mitigation strategies with automated robo-advisors and algorithmic trading platforms like Robo-Advisors and Algo Trading platforms may also prove effective at mitigating risks. These tools automatically adjust your portfolio based on risk tolerance and current market conditions – like having someone as your co-pilot who takes over in times of trouble.

Conclusion: Balancing Technology with Traditional Wisdom

Technology offers investors powerful tools, but integrating it with traditional wisdom is necessary for a balanced approach. Keep an open mind but remember the tried-and-true principles when considering innovations; stay informed while remaining flexible as successful investment strategies evolve.
